Weather in May

May, the last month of the spring in Thompson, is a comfortable month, with an average temperature varying between 47.8°F (8.8°C) and 64.9°F (18.3°C).

Temperature

As Thompson transitions into May, a marked increase in the average high-temperature is observed, rising from a frosty 49.8°F (9.9°C) in April to an enjoyable 64.9°F (18.3°C). Thompson's average low-temperature is measured at a frosty 47.8°F (8.8°C) during May.

Humidity

In Thompson, the average relative humidity in May is 63%.

Rainfall

In May, in Thompson, the rain falls for 11.7 days. Throughout May, 1.14" (29mm) of precipitation is accumulated. In Thompson, North Dakota, during the entire year, the rain falls for 80.3 days and collects up to 10.47" (266mm) of precipitation.

Snowfall

Months with snowfall in Thompson are January through May, October through December. May is the last month it regularly snows in Thompson. During 0.3 snowfall days, in May, Thompson aggregates 0.08" (2mm) of snow. In Thompson, during the entire year, snow falls for 54.6 days and aggregates up to 11.54" (293mm) of snow.

Daylight

In Thompson, the average length of the day in May is 15h and 11min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 6:09 am and sunset at 8:41 pm. On the last day of May, sunrise is at 5:34 am and sunset at 9:18 pm CDT.

Sunshine

The average sunshine in May is 8.8h.

UV index

The average daily maximum UV index in May is 4. A UV Index of 3 to 5 symbolizes a moderate threat to health from unsafe exposure to UV radiation for average individuals.
